Pavers Hardscaping in Fairfield County, CT
Pavers hardscaping services involve the installation and design of durable, aesthetically appealing paved surfaces on residential properties. These services typically cover projects such as pat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or seating areas, providing a functional and attractive addition to outdoor spaces. Homeowners often seek pavers hardscaping to enhance curb appeal, create defined outdoor living areas, or improve the durability of surfaces exposed to foot or vehicle traffic. Before requesting these services, property owners should consider factors like the desired design style, the type of paving materials, and the overall layout to ensure the finished project aligns with their aesthetic and practical needs.
When planning pavers hardscaping projects, property owners usually want to understand the range of available materials, such as concrete, brick, or natural stone, and how each impacts the look and longevity of the surface. It’s also helpful to consider the scope of the project, including size, pattern options, and any necessary site preparation. Clarifying these details can help ensure the project meets expectations and fits within the property’s landscape design, making it a valuable addition to any outdoor environment.
Many property owners in Fairfield County, CT look into Pavers Hardscaping for repairs, replacements, upgrades, and appearance-related improvements.

Pavers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for pavers hardscaping? Pavers are ideal for pat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or seating areas, providing durable and attractive surfaces for various outdoor spaces.
Are pavers a good choice for outdoor surfaces? Yes, pavers are weather-resistant, low-maintenance, and available in many styles, making them a practical option for outdoor hardscaping.
What materials are commonly used for pavers?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different aesthetic and durability options.
How does pavers hardscaping enhance property value? Well-designed paver installations can improve curb appeal and functionality, potentially increasing overall property value.
